Why December?
Tenerife in December is the closest reliable winter sun escape from the UK. Temperatures average 20–22°C — warm enough for sitting outside, walking, and enjoying the resort atmosphere. Christmas week and New Year are the most expensive periods of the Tenerife year — book well in advance or expect to pay premium prices. Puerto de la Cruz in the north holds a charming traditional Christmas market. Las Canteras beach in Gran Canaria is particularly popular for Christmas and New Year celebrations. The Canarian Christmas tradition of lighting bonfires on Christmas Eve is a distinctive local event.

Honest warning: December is peak pricing for Tenerife — particularly Christmas week and New Year. Prices can be 50–100% above November levels for the same accommodation. Book 12–16 weeks ahead. The Christmas and New Year period is extremely popular with British and German long-stay visitors, so resort atmospheres are very full.
